1. Secure Your Living Space

Before bringing your French Bulldog puppy home, it’s vital to secure your living space. Start by ensuring that all doors and windows are securely closed and locked to prevent any escape attempts. You should also install baby gates in areas where you don’t want your puppy to access, such as the kitchen or bathroom.

2. Remove Hazardous Items

To ensure your French Bulldog puppy’s safety, it’s essential to remove any hazardous items from your living space. This includes chemicals, cleaning supplies, sharp objects, cords, and small objects that your puppy could swallow. You should also keep your trash can securely closed to prevent your puppy from getting into it.

3. Secure Electrical Outlets

French Bulldog puppies are curious and love to explore their surroundings, including electrical outlets. To prevent any accidents, it’s essential to secure all electrical outlets in your living space. You can do this by using outlet covers or securing cords and cables to the wall so that your puppy can’t chew on them.

4. Choose Safe Toys

French Bulldog puppies love to play, and providing them with safe toys is essential. Avoid toys with small parts that your puppy could swallow, and make sure that all toys are made from non-toxic materials. You should also supervise your puppy during playtime to ensure that they don’t accidentally swallow or choke on any toys.

5. Create a Comfortable Space

Creating a comfortable space for your French Bulldog puppy is essential for their well-being. Provide them with a cozy bed, toys, and a comfortable temperature. You should also ensure that your puppy has access to fresh water at all times.

6. Monitor Your Puppy

Even with all the necessary precautions in place, accidents can still happen. It’s essential to monitor your French Bulldog puppy at all times, especially during the first few weeks in your home. Keep an eye out for any signs of distress, such as excessive barking, whining, or chewing.
